Convert Gram-force to Newton

Unit definitions

Gram-force

Gram-force is the force exerted by a mass of one gram in standard gravity ($gₙ$) ($1\ \text{kgf} = 9.806\,65\ \text{N}$).

Newton

The newton is the SI unit of force. It is the force required to accelerate a mass of one kilogram at a rate of one meter per second squared.

How to convert Gram-force to Newton

$$\text{Force}_{\text{N}} = \text{Force}_{\text{gf}} \cdot 0.00980665$$

Examples

Example 1

Convert $45.0\ \text{gf}$ to $\text{N}$.

$$\text{Force}_{\text{N}} = 45.0 \cdot 0.00980665$$

$$\text{Force}_{\text{N}} = 0.441299$$

$$\therefore \ 45.0\ \text{gf} = 0.441299 \ \text{N}$$
